The metal roofing installation process begins with a thorough inspection of your current roof. This involves checking for any underlying damage, such as rot or compromised decking, that needs to be addressed before new materials are applied. Once the assessment is complete, the existing roofing material is carefully removed, ensuring a clean surface. A protective underlayment is then installed, acting as a crucial barrier against moisture and ice dams. This layer is vital for preventing leaks and protecting the home's structure. Metal panels are precisely measured and cut to fit your roof's unique design. Installation involves securing these panels with specialized fasteners, ensuring they are resistant to wind and the elements Cleveland experiences. Flashing around vents, chimneys, and skylights is meticulously installed to create a watertight seal. The crew then completes a full site cleanup. When you start looking at a new roof, the final number depends on a few specific things. The total surface area is the biggest factor, but the steepness of your roof and how many stories your house has will change the labor intensity. We also look at the current material—stripping off old layers adds to the disposal fees. Choosing between asphalt shingles, metal, or tile shifts the budget significantly. Finally, if we find damaged decking underneath once the old roof is off, that needs replacement to ensure a solid structure.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.
Polycarbonate panels are lightweight, impact-resistant sheets that allow light to pass through. They are commonly used for patio covers, sunrooms, or areas where you want a roof that isn't completely opaque. These panels are much stronger than glass and offer good UV protection. If you are looking to cover an outdoor living space while keeping the area bright and airy, these panels provide a balance between shelter and natural lighting. Metal roof colors for Cleveland homes can vary, but darker colors tend to absorb more heat, which can be beneficial during the cold winters by helping to melt snow and ice. Lighter colors reflect more sunlight, which can reduce cooling costs in the summer. The choice often depends on aesthetic preference and desired energy efficiency outcomes for the Cleveland climate.

Commercial roofing near Cleveland requires durable, long-lasting solutions that can withstand the region's varied weather. Flat or low-slope roofs are common, and materials like EPDM, TPO, or standing seam metal are often used. Proper drainage, insulation, and resistance to snow and ice are critical factors. Professional installation and maintenance are essential for commercial properties.
